Answer:

TU = 8.4

Explanation:

The geometric figure consists of the following segments;

1) 4 parallel lines, WS, YR, XQ, and, VP

2) Three transversals, VW, PS, and, TU

The given parameters are;

PQ = QR = RS

Therefore, given that the transversal, PS, makes equal intercept with the 4 given parallel lines, by equal intercept theorem, the transversal TU will make equal intercepts with the given parallel lines

Therefore;

TX = 2.8 = XZ = ZU

From which we have, by segment addition postulate;

TU = TX + XZ + ZU

∴ TU = 2.8 + 2.8 + 2.8 = 8.4

TU = 8.4.
